ba81925c1d 
								
							
								 
							
						 
						
							
							
								
								renamed smt2smtsolver to smtlibsmtsolver and cleaned make files  
							
							
 
							
							
							Former-commit-id: 78c74dc9a5 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								434f1a4903 
								
							
								 
							
						 
						
							
							
								
								obtain scheduler from value iteration  
							
							
 
							
							
							Former-commit-id: ef976fbd6e 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b243057884 
								
							
								 
							
						 
						
							
							
								
								fix in eliminateAll  
							
							
 
							
							
							Former-commit-id: 93f753d148 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								04cb930bda 
								
							
								 
							
						 
						
							
							
								
								removed copied debug output at a silly place  
							
							
 
							
							
							Former-commit-id: 27946240f5 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								548ba8bbeb 
								
							
								 
							
						 
						
							
							
								
								somehow managed my way through the policy guessing, several minor extensions to solvers  
							
							
 
							
							
							Former-commit-id: c4bb6453e7 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								051ad702a7 
								
							
								 
							
						 
						
							
							
								
								solvers updated, constants updated  
							
							
 
							
							
							Former-commit-id: 011251c695 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b67e3d6e7b 
								
							
								 
							
						 
						
							
							
								
								added 'convergence' (rather success) checks for Eigen solver  
							
							
 
							
							
							Former-commit-id: 25a6fb1d77 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								a5c09fa801 
								
							
								 
							
						 
						
							
							
								
								extended eliminator interface, merged model checking part  
							
							
 
							
							
							Former-commit-id: 5e0028c937 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								ee4cb38d43 
								
							
								 
							
						 
						
							
							
								
								lra into multivalueeliminator  
							
							
 
							
							
							Former-commit-id: 981aebe161 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								31228486d3 
								
							
								 
							
						 
						
							
							
								
								towards merging, including a extension on the pstateeliminator, come back after generalizing the lra eliminator  
							
							
 
							
							
							Former-commit-id: 8ce98b8287 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								437e883bcf 
								
							
								 
							
						 
						
							
							
								
								first fixes after merge  
							
							
 
							
							
							Former-commit-id: f19347885d 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								566cef0f91 
								
							
								 
							
						 
						
							
							
								
								Started on compiling without Carl  
							
							
 
							
							
							Former-commit-id: 5e0895d7c5 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								83c4b1647c 
								
							
								 
							
						 
						
							
							
								
								solvers now can allocated auxiliary memory  
							
							
 
							
							
							Former-commit-id: 76dc1a1679 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								be5fdeb636 
								
							
								 
							
						 
						
							
							
								
								started working on internal auxiliary storage of solvers  
							
							
 
							
							
							Former-commit-id: d895041c50 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								95b95d9c64 
								
							
								 
							
						 
						
							
							
								
								fixed some minor issues and renamed equation solver methods slightly to make the names a bit more compact  
							
							
 
							
							
							Former-commit-id: de103e19ad 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b1f2c26df0 
								
							
								 
							
						 
						
							
							
								
								made all instantiations to call MDP model checking with rational numbers  
							
							
 
							
							
							Former-commit-id: d3f8df7804 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								d27c75c3d8 
								
							
								 
							
						 
						
							
							
								
								fixed missing virtual keyword  
							
							
 
							
							
							Former-commit-id: 1aa26ab679 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								61a8b9bb29 
								
							
								 
							
						 
						
							
							
								
								more work on solvers  
							
							
 
							
							
							Former-commit-id: 14fad8ac36 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9ab33528b4 
								
							
								 
							
						 
						
							
							
								
								started to fill value iteration implementation in new general min-max solver  
							
							
 
							
							
							Former-commit-id: e54cb8a0f9 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								b4e0cabef6 
								
							
								 
							
						 
						
							
							
								
								started working on general min-max solver that uses an underlying linear equation solver. provided necessary factories. adapted code and removed old min-max solvers  
							
							
 
							
							
							Former-commit-id: c1895472c7 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								8153306ced 
								
							
								 
							
						 
						
							
							
								
								fixed wrong call to Eigen's iterative solvers  
							
							
 
							
							
							Former-commit-id: 0e2e836729 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								46ce68743c 
								
							
								 
							
						 
						
							
							
								
								enabled precision/max iterations for eigen solver  
							
							
 
							
							
							Former-commit-id: 370a78a02f 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								2a7dc0fad0 
								
							
								 
							
						 
						
							
							
								
								renamed MarkovChainSettings  
							
							
 
							
							
							Former-commit-id: 39024731f8 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								07c787b49d 
								
							
								 
							
						 
						
							
							
								
								added unsupported solvers of eigen  
							
							
 
							
							
							Former-commit-id: e11b335c2d 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								d24fb0cf9a 
								
							
								 
							
						 
						
							
							
								
								avoid temporary in Eigen solver by providing .noalias(). slightly rewrote matrix-vector expression to benefit more from Eigen's optimization capabilities  
							
							
 
							
							
							Former-commit-id: 838eac1449 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								69da4ff147 
								
							
								 
							
						 
						
							
							
								
								fixed some more problems with Eigen solver  
							
							
 
							
							
							Former-commit-id: c6ed18c4ab 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f46bcd31c5 
								
							
								 
							
						 
						
							
							
								
								fixed typo  
							
							
 
							
							
							Former-commit-id: 0e6ab55389 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								ba43e23984 
								
							
								 
							
						 
						
							
							
								
								using maps for Eigen solver instead of copies of the vectors  
							
							
 
							
							
							Former-commit-id: d53075ab36 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								00d331ebb4 
								
							
								 
							
						 
						
							
							
								
								moved linear equation solver factories to the respective solver files (and away from utility). restructured settings in factories and the way they are forwarded to the linear equation solvers. fixed all resulting errors  
							
							
 
							
							
							Former-commit-id: 27e1ae2466 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								15a4d4757f 
								
							
								 
							
						 
						
							
							
								
								added feature to linear equation solver factories to take posession of the matrix to forward it to the solvers  
							
							
 
							
							
							Former-commit-id: ed183f1820 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								40a7948540 
								
							
								 
							
						 
						
							
							
								
								started generalizing elimination to equation system solving  
							
							
 
							
							
							Former-commit-id: aabe89b65f 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								13f8f21a70 
								
							
								 
							
						 
						
							
							
								
								upgrade to eigen 3.3 and made modifications for different value types via template specializations  
							
							
 
							
							
							Former-commit-id: 8ea9d1e0c4 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								852afd1718 
								
							
								 
							
						 
						
							
							
								
								fixed crowds models to work with exact arithmetic. fixed dynamic state priority queue implementation. added setting to use dedicated elimination-based model checker instead of regular model checker (+ elimination solver)  
							
							
 
							
							
							Former-commit-id: 1b0802ff05 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								82d4164c39 
								
							
								 
							
						 
						
							
							
								
								added obeying a state ordering to elimination linear equation solver  
							
							
 
							
							
							Former-commit-id: 5a62842963 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f3fa90cc37 
								
							
								 
							
						 
						
							
							
								
								more work towards exact solving  
							
							
 
							
							
							Former-commit-id: 38edbcf2ca 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								be9648fc18 
								
							
								 
							
						 
						
							
							
								
								Added -fPIC to Sylvan. Since it is linked into Storm it is necessary for relocation to be possible, hence PIC.  
							
							
 
							
							
							Added includes for cmath at various points. This is a default include on Mac OS but not on any sane systems.
Changed calls to std::abs to std::fabs to resolve ambigious call errors.
Former-commit-id: 4d3da21bce 
							
						 
						9 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								4e14ecb869 
								
							
								 
							
						 
						
							
							
								
								made elimination-based linear solver work in an alpha version. changed minor things in Eigen's SparseLU implementation to make it work with rational numbers and rational functions  
							
							
 
							
							
							Former-commit-id: e5622bd981 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								8ce9e56af8 
								
							
								 
							
						 
						
							
							
								
								some refactoring of state-elimination-related things  
							
							
 
							
							
							Former-commit-id: c51fd9c47c 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								a17cffbbe3 
								
							
								 
							
						 
						
							
							
								
								added missing switch case for new eigen solver  
							
							
 
							
							
							Former-commit-id: fbbb6e5828 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								023325b53d 
								
							
								 
							
						 
						
							
							
								
								added tests for Eigen solver  
							
							
 
							
							
							Former-commit-id: ede9efcee2 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								bb700457de 
								
							
								 
							
						 
						
							
							
								
								some minor fixes  
							
							
 
							
							
							Former-commit-id: f114c397f6 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								74ee726e35 
								
							
								 
							
						 
						
							
							
								
								fixed some typos  
							
							
 
							
							
							Former-commit-id: de3cd92c62 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								1b6137cc5d 
								
							
								 
							
						 
						
							
							
								
								Changed some assert to STORM_LOG_ASSERT  
							
							
 
							
							
							Former-commit-id: 04c320dac9 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								81b4fa6b9b 
								
							
								 
							
						 
						
							
							
								
								added composition specification to PRISM program  
							
							
 
							
							
							Former-commit-id: 2c032f5d7e 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								86c233f3df 
								
							
								 
							
						 
						
							
							
								
								fixed bug in sylvan  
							
							
 
							
							
							Former-commit-id: 3f3a3df83d 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								effadc5cca 
								
							
								 
							
						 
						
							
							
								
								Split into general settings and markov chain settings  
							
							
 
							
							
							Former-commit-id: 619a2e3622 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								67d77608bd 
								
							
								 
							
						 
						
							
							
								
								Refactoring of settings  
							
							
 
							
							
							Former-commit-id: ea4350fc1c 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f285858e28 
								
							
								 
							
						 
						
							
							
								
								added required includes  
							
							
 
							
							
							Former-commit-id: c523950b43 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								e0980de0ba 
								
							
								 
							
						 
						
							
							
								
								first version of storm without log4cplus as a dependency  
							
							
 
							
							
							Former-commit-id: 5aa64fabd7 
							
						 
						10 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								08bed36579 
								
							
								 
							
						 
						
							
							
								
								fixed an issue in performance tests and renamed all remaining LOG4CPLUS macro invocations to that of storm  
							
							
 
							
							
							Former-commit-id: 8536943978 
							
						 
						10 years ago